MxCC Employee Sets Men's World Record for Stationary Biking

Trenton Wright of Middlesex Community College took the Guinness Book of World Records challenge and cycled for 12 hours straight last Saturday at the Middletown YMCA — raising $2,500 for both organizations.

 

Trenton Wright hasn't let seven knee surgeries slow him down — or hamper his ability to raise money for his two favorite causes through bicycle marathons.

Wright, 58, coordinator of Institutional Advancement at Middlesex Community College, set the men's World Record for Farthest Distance on a Static Cycle (Stationary Bike) at 187.13 miles in 12 hours on Feb. 23.

This fundraiser for the Northern Middlesex YMCA and Middlesex Community College Foundation was his second such bicycle benefit. Last year, Wright raised more than $500 for the YMCA during its 5-hour Spin-A-Thon. This year, he's collected about $2,500 which will be split between the YMCA and MxCC Foundation.

The current World Record for 12 hours is held by Fabienne Muller of Switzerland at 201.4 miles. Guinness World Records had said it would entertain opening a 12-hour category for a male if Wright beat Muller's distance. He was ahead of the female record through nine hours.

Wright was on the stationary bike from 6 a.m. to 6 p.m. The original plan was to set a pace of 17 mph and he actually achieved a 15.59 mph pace over 12 hours. Once finished, Wright said, “it wasn’t pretty and it wasn’t easy.”  

"The seat was to be replaced with a proper competitive seat and that did not get done and that caused major problems for my rear that prompted some unanticipated breaks in the 10- to 12-hour time frame.” 

Wright is a former Division III cross-country and track athlete for Eastern Connecticut State University. He is a 1976 graduate of ECSU and a 1979 graduate of the University of Connecticut, where he received a master of public administration degree. He resides in Willimantic and Old Lyme and has had a total of seven knee surgeries and has a metal plate and two screws in his right knee.
